General Description

3-ForMyliMidazo[1,5-a]pyridine-1-carboxylic acid, also known as FMP-1, is a chemical compound with potential applications in medicinal chemistry and drug development. It is a fused heterocyclic compound that contains a pyridine ring and a carboxylic acid group. FMP-1 has been studied for its potential as an anticancer agent, with research suggesting it may have the ability to inhibit the growth of cancer cells. Additionally, it has shown promise as an anti-inflammatory and antioxidant agent, with potential applications in the treatment of inflammatory and oxidative stress-related diseases. Further research is needed to fully understand the biological activities and potential therapeutic uses of 3-ForMyliMidazo[1,5-a]pyridine-1-carboxylic acid.

Check Digit Verification of cas no

The CAS Registry Mumber 1039356-95-0 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,0,3,9,3,5 and 6 respectively; the second part has 2 digits, 9 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 1039356-95:
(9*1)+(8*0)+(7*3)+(6*9)+(5*3)+(4*5)+(3*6)+(2*9)+(1*5)=160
160 % 10 = 0
So 1039356-95-0 is a valid CAS Registry Number.
